Effect of Power Tiller Weight on the Field Performance

A power tiller having rated power of 6.71kW and weight of 350kg was tested to determine the optimum weight of power tiller for better tractive performance. The experiment was conducted in uncultivated land (silty loam, 12.66% m.c.(d.b.)). The maximum drawbar power was found to be 0.545kW with the present weight at the speed and slip of 0.344(m/s) and 31.5(%) respectively. With the addition of extra weight of 40kg at the speed and slip of 0.368(m/s) and 26.4(%) maximum drawbar power of 0.82kW was obtained. The draft at maximum drawbar power was 1.57, 1.62, 2.21, 2.06, 2.25 kN for the extra weight of 0, 20, 40, 60 & 80 kg respectively.
